26/08/2024 (Agence Europe) – Today’s largest cruise ships are twice as big as they were in 2000, according to a report by the NGO network Transport & Environment (T&E) published on Thursday 8 August. At this rate, these ships could reach 345,000 gross tonnes by 2050, almost eight times more than the Titanic. “This is a problem for the environment”, according to T&E, which is calling on companies to invest in green technologies in order to reduce their environmental impact.
